Link table or Concatenate

Hi,

I have a scenario where I have 2 KPIs, both of them derived using separate queries,

Query1Query2
YearYear
MonthMonth
Key1Key1
Key2Key2
KPI1KPI2

   

The combination of Key1 and Key2 would be the primary key.

Now I need to join Query 1 and Query 2 with other queries, 10 of them. 10 needs to be joined with either KPIs.

Whats the best way to create the data model?

May be we can follow many ways, I am assuming

Scenario-1

Load *, Key1 & Key2 as PrimaryKey from Query1;

Concatenate

Load *, Key1 & Key2 as PrimaryKey from Query2;


Scenario-2

Query1:

Load *, AutoNumberHash128(Key1, Key2) as PrimaryKey;

Load Year, Month, Key1, Key2, KPI1 from Query1;

Query2:

Load *, AutoNumberHash128(Key1, Key2) as PrimaryKey;

Load Year, Month, Key1, Key2, KPI1 from Query2;


Scenario-3

Query1:

Load Year, Month, Key1, Key2, KPI1, 'Query1' as Flag from Query1;

Query2:

Load Year, Month, Key1, Key2, KPI1, 'Query2' as Flag from Query1;


Or, Link table also easy way
